Salary: A GBP 60,000 - A GBP 70,000 (DOE)
We're searching for an exceptional General Manager to lead a beautifully appointed, intimate fine dining restaurant. This is an opportunity for a hands-on leader who thrives on delivering outstanding guest experiences and leading from the floor. The ideal candidate is passionate about hospitality, enjoys being visible and engaged with both guests and the team, and is committed to developing people through coaching and training.

What We're Looking For
- Proven experience as a General Manager or senior restaurant leader.
- A true floor presence: someone who leads by example and is actively involved in service.
- Strong leadership skills with a genuine passion for training, mentoring, and developing high-performing teams.
- Excellent wine knowledge and confidence in delivering a premium guest experience.
- Experience within fine dining or Michelin-starred restaurants is highly desirable.
- We also welcome applications from exceptional leaders in premium restaurants who are ready to take the next step into fine dining.
